CARTO3 File Format#

This document contains information and a few pointers on the terminology used both inside the CARTO3 file format and also in this library. There’s also a replicating python class associated to each of these parts that will hold the information after reading (listed at the bottom of the section).

Map#

During a study, multiple maps a generated according to the need of the attending staff (e.g. pre- and post ablation). Each map contains:

  • A mesh with which to associate the recordings

  • Multiple points with electrical recordings. These are not registered to the mesh

Associated class: CartoMap.

Point#

Each point represents an electrical recording at a single location. A point contains not just the position, but also ECG and EGM readings over time.

Associated class: CartoPointDetailData.
